Advanced Lubricant Diagnostics for Industrial Applications
To optimize performance in demanding industrial environments, advanced lubricant diagnostics have become crucial. These sophisticated techniques go beyond routine oil analysis by utilizing a combination of monitoring devices to provide real-time insights into the condition of lubricants and their impact on machinery health. By analyzing parameters such as viscosity, temperature, and wear particle concentration, these systems can detect early signs of degradation before catastrophic events occur. This proactive approach not only minimizes downtime but also extends the operational duration of critical equipment, ultimately leading to significant cost savings and improved productivity.
Advanced Oil Analysis for Enhanced Performance and Reliability
In today's demanding industrial landscape, maximizing equipment efficiency is paramount. Cutting-edge oil analysis has emerged as a critical tool for achieving this goal. By meticulously examining the chemical and physical properties of lubricant oil, technicians can glean invaluable insights into the health and status of machinery. These analyses go beyond simple viscosity checks, delving into parameters such as debris levels, wear metal content, and oxidation products. Armed with this data, maintenance teams can proactively address potential issues before they escalate into costly downtime or catastrophic failure.
- Furthermore, oil analysis enables precise lubricant management by providing guidance on optimal replacement intervals. This reduces unnecessary oil consumption and minimizes environmental impact.
